Library furniture upgrade hits its completion

The third installment of the library’s space upgrade was completed on September 2017 when the set of new furniture was delivered and installed at the Periodicals and Theses Section. High tables and chairs lined the windows for individual study space while big tables and matching side chairs were placed in the middle of the room to accommodate group collaboration. A digital board was set up to feature the recent journal issues available and the latest multimedia resources. This is on top of the three (3) new LED TVs installed in the lobbies of the library to inform users of announcements, news, and activities.

Zones have also been established in the different areas of the library to foster environments which suit the diverse needs of users. It was intended to develop a culture of responsible use of space while considering the interests of others whom they share the space with. The Medicine Section was designated as Silent Space where speaking or making noise is not allowed while the rest of the library sections were assigned as Quiet Spaces where there is very little or no noise. The discussion rooms were marked as Collaborative Spaces.

This rounds up the fresh look and feel of the library building by transforming space to be responsive to the needs of the users. The first upgrade happened on October 2015 at the Medicine Section while the second upgrade occurred on February 2017 at the Allied Health and Reference Section.
